NIO flagNicaraguan Córdoba
(NIO) Insights

Currency of Central America's largest nation by area; remittance-dependent economy (Nicaragua second only to Honduras in LatAm remittance/GDP ratio); coffee, gold, and textiles key exports; Ortega authoritarian government increasing isolation; 2018 – Social security protests, political crisis

NIO Market Insights

Deep-dive analysis of the Nicaraguan Córdoba's global impact, remittance role, and institutional influence.

Strong Currency Impact

Strong Currency Impact

Cheaper imports; lower coffee/gold revenues; lower inflation; remittances worth less in córdobas

Weak Currency Impact

Weak Currency Impact

Higher remittance values; boosts coffee and gold exports; higher import costs; inflation

Remittance Role

Remittance Role

Nicaragua is highly remittance-dependent (~$4.8 billion/year, ~25% GDP); almost entirely from USA and Costa Rica

Central Bank Tools

Central Bank Tools

Policy Rate, FX interventions, Reserve Requirements
